A Johnstown man is accused of drug possession in connection with an incident Sunday night in East Wheatfield Township. State police say that at 8:59 PM, troopers pulled over a car at the intersection of Route 56 East and McCormick Road for running a stop sign that had flashing red lights. The driver, identified as 61-year-old Anthony Ponce, was found to be under the influence of a controlled substance, and suspected methamphetamine was found in the car. Ponce was taken into custody and he submitted to a legal blood draw and released. Charges are pending the results of the blood test.
State police are investigating the theft of chicken coops in Armstrong Township. The theft allegedly happened last Wednesday at 1:00 PM at a property along Route 422. The coops belonged to a 38-year-old Marion Center woman. The investigation into the thefts is continuing.
